Bypassing the overflow hose on a 1998 Chevy Blazer is not recommended, as it can lead to fuel spilling, potential fire hazards, and damage to the fuel system. The overflow hose is designed to prevent fuel from overflowing and to manage pressure in the tank. Modifying or bypassing this system can also violate safety regulations. It's best to address any issues with the overflow hose rather than attempting to bypass it.
